If you’re planning to build a house, one of the most important material questions is how many board feet of lumber to build a house.

There isn’t one universal answer because lumber requirements depend on the home’s size, design, number of stories, framing system, roof design, floor plan, wall height, openings, and structural requirements.

As a broad planning estimate, a conventionally wood-framed house may require several thousand to tens of thousands of board feet of lumber, depending on its size and construction.

For example, a typical 2,000-square-foot wood-framed house could require roughly 12,000โ€“18,000 board feet of framing lumber, although the actual quantity can vary significantly.

It’s important to understand that “board feet” is a volume measurement, not simply a count of boards. A board foot represents a piece of lumber measuring 1 foot long ร— 1 foot wide ร— 1 inch thick.

For an actual construction project, a detailed lumber takeoff should be prepared from the architectural and structural plans.

What Is a Board Foot?

Before calculating how much lumber a house requires, it’s important to understand what a board foot means.

A board foot measures lumber volume.

The standard formula is:

Board Feet = Length (ft) ร— Width (in) ร— Thickness (in) รท 12

For example, a board that is:

  • 10 feet long
  • 6 inches wide
  • 1 inch thick

contains:

10 ร— 6 ร— 1 รท 12 = 5 board feet

Therefore, that board contains 5 board feet.

Does Board-Foot Estimation Include Plywood?

Usually, when someone asks about the number of board feet of lumber needed to build a house, they’re referring primarily to solid-sawn lumber volume.

Plywood and other structural panels are typically measured separately.

For example:

  • Dimensional lumber โ†’ board feet or linear feet
  • Plywood โ†’ square feet or sheets
  • Engineered wood โ†’ manufacturer-specific units

A complete construction material estimate should therefore separate these categories.


How to Calculate Board Feet for Individual Boards

Suppose you need 2ร—6 boards that are 12 feet long.

Using nominal dimensions:

2 ร— 6 ร— 12 รท 12 = 12 board feet

Therefore, one nominal 2ร—6ร—12 contains approximately:

12 board feet

If you need 100 such boards:

100 ร— 12 = 1,200 board feet

This method can be repeated for each lumber size in a material list.


Nominal vs. Actual Lumber Dimensions

One important detail is that dimensional lumber is commonly sold using nominal dimensions, while its actual dimensions are smaller after processing.

For example, a nominal 2ร—4 is actually approximately:

1.5 ร— 3.5 inches

The same issue applies to other dimensional lumber sizes.

When estimating lumber purchases, use the method and dimensions specified by your lumber supplier or estimating system.

This prevents discrepancies between theoretical board-foot calculations and actual purchased quantities.


How to Estimate Lumber for House Framing

A basic lumber takeoff typically considers each major structural component.

Step 1: Measure Exterior Walls

Determine the total linear footage of exterior walls.

Step 2: Calculate Stud Requirements

Estimate the number of wall studs based on spacing and wall configuration.

Step 3: Add Plates

Calculate the lumber required for top and bottom plates.

Step 4: Estimate Headers

Account for doors, windows, and other openings.

Step 5: Calculate Floor Framing

Include joists, beams, rim boards, and other structural components.

Step 6: Calculate Roof Framing

Include rafters, ridge boards, ceiling framing, or trusses where applicable.

Step 7: Add Interior Framing

Estimate interior partition walls and structural walls.

Step 8: Add Waste

Include an appropriate allowance for cutting and construction waste.

This process produces a much more useful estimate than multiplying house square footage by a generic number.

Single-Story vs. Two-Story House Lumber Requirements

Two homes with the same total floor area can require different amounts of lumber.

For example:

Single-story 2,000-square-foot house

The roof and exterior walls cover a relatively large footprint.

Two-story 2,000-square-foot house

The building footprint may be only around 1,000 square feet per floor.

This changes:

  • Exterior wall length
  • Foundation layout
  • Floor framing
  • Roof size
  • Interior framing
  • Structural loads

Therefore, a 2,000-square-foot house isn’t necessarily associated with one fixed amount of lumber.

Board Feet vs. Linear Feet

These measurements are not interchangeable.

Board Feet

Measures lumber volume.

Linear Feet

Measures length.

For example, you might need:

1,000 linear feet of 2ร—4 lumber

but the board-foot volume depends on the size of those boards.

For a nominal 2ร—4:

2 ร— 4 ร— 1 รท 12 = 0.667 board feet per linear foot

So 1,000 linear feet of nominal 2ร—4 lumber represents approximately:

667 board feet


Board Feet vs. Square Feet

These measurements describe completely different things.

Square feet measure area.

Board feet measure lumber volume.

For example:

  • A house may have 2,000 square feet of floor area.
  • Its framing lumber might total 15,000 board feet.

You cannot directly convert square feet of house area into board feet without making assumptions about the construction.
